BDP Gaborone region saddled with protests

No Image

The Botswana Democratic Party (BDP) Gaborone region will today (Friday) make a decision regarding two protests of the two constituencies before them regarding election of delegates.

Gaborone region is made up of five constituencies that include Gaborone South, Gaborone North, Gaborone Central, Gaborone Bonnington North and Gaborone Bonnington South. Three constituencies out of five had voted peacefully while there has been two protested in Gaborone Bonnington North and Gaborone South.

Party members are fighting for voting rights at the BDP congress that will be held starting next week Friday.  Observers are of the view that the BDP congress will be another unity test for the party. Recently the BDP members have been fighting over the issue of the delegates. The members are divided into two factions, led by Vice President Mokgweetsi Masisi and Nonofo Molefhi. The two are fighting for the chairpersonship of the BDP.
